Pros & Cons Breakdown

Wrike

Pros
  • AI features included in all plans
  • 400+ integrations
  • Powerful proofing and approval tools
  • Custom workflows and fields
  • Gantt charts with dependencies
  • 2025 Gartner Magic Quadrant Leader
  • 14-day free trial on all plans
Cons
  • Business plan expensive at $24.80/user
  • Learning curve for advanced features
  • Limited storage on lower tiers

Trello

Pros
  • Very easy to learn and use
  • Visual Kanban boards
  • Great free plan
  • Power-Ups for extensions
  • Fast and responsive
  • Good mobile apps
Cons
  • Limited to Kanban style
  • Basic reporting
  • Not ideal for complex projects

Thinking of Switching?

Switching project management tools affects your whole team. Most tools offer data export, but workflows and automations won't transfer. Plan for a transition period where you might run both systems briefly.
